The Housing and Advancement Board (HDB) money ceiling is a crucial aspect that determines eligibility for a variety of public housing schemes in Singapore. It sets the maximum home profits that a spouse and children can get paid to qualify for paying for or leasing an HDB flat at backed costs. Eligibility Criteria
To get suitable for subsidized HDB flats underneath various strategies like Establish-To-Order (BTO), Sale of Harmony Flats (SBF), or Rental Flats techniques, applicants should meet up with certain conditions connected to their house money:
Optimum Profits Restrict: The precise earnings ceilings are established dependant on various factors like citizenship standing, style of flat used for, and whether or not one particular has gained any past housing grants.
For very first-timer family members: The existing most month-to-month gross family revenue is SGD 14,000.
For 2nd-timer households & extended households: The current highest regular monthly gross blended house incomes are SGD 21,000 and SGD 28,000 respectively.
Merged Residence Profits: The overall gross regular salary from all working members throughout the exact spouse and children must not exceed the prescribed limit.
Citizenship Status: Applicants should be possibly Singapore Citizens or Long-lasting Inhabitants being qualified for subsidized general public housing.
Preceding Housing Grant Receipts: Dependant upon earlier housing subsidies obtained from government techniques like Specific CPF Housing Grant (SHG) or Extra CPF Housing Grant (AHG), the income ceilings may perhaps differ.
It's important to notice that cash flow ceilings are topic to periodic revision via the HDB, thinking of inflation charges, financial problems, and authorities insurance policies.
